Why is a written constitution important quizlet?

A written constitution is important because it binds down rulers or people that have power, and stops them from creating unjust laws and policies.Click to see full answer. Also asked, why is a written constitution important for governing a state quizlet?It contains the main rules governing the power of the state and relationship between the state and individuals. It is a very important document for citizens of the state and it prevent the state from abusing its powers, and safeguards the rights of the individual.Also Know, is a written constitution necessary? A written constitution is necessary to ensure legal clarity. The very idea of having a constitution is to limit the powers of the State (i.e. the Government).
